Output 168831d20bae182e7d50ec7d00443552826ec266f4d6c5222f77dd2ece254e42:2

value
217000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aba67f9a902a2642302f6e170d6739c68b2c047 OP_EQUAL
address
32fjzBtrhGYiVJGUh83VN9j3YXVrKsmAyL
transaction
168831d20bae182e7d50ec7d00443552826ec266f4d6c5222f77dd2ece254e42
spent
true